José Emilio Pacheco
José Emilio Pacheco was a renowned Mexican poet, essayist, novelist, and short story writer. He is considered one of the most important Mexican writers of the 20th century, known for his profound and accessible literary works. Pacheco received numerous awards throughout his career, including the Miguel de Cervantes Prize in 2009.

1. Las Batallas En El Desierto
Set in post-World War II Mexico City, the story follows Carlos, a young boy who navigates the complexities of adolescence amidst rapid social and political change. As he grapples with his feelings for Mariana, the mother of his friend, Carlos's innocent infatuation highlights the cultural tensions and moral dilemmas of the era. Through his eyes, the narrative explores themes of love, memory, and the inevitable loss of innocence, painting a vivid picture of a society in transition.
